"Saving association rules into a model"


Hi everyone,
i want to know how i can save the association rules generated by the "Association Rules Generator" to a model? to integrate them into a Java application.

this should be asked in the development forum, don't you think?
Anyway, you simply can't do that. Association Rules are a special IOObject of their own, but you can apply them on an ExampleSet using the according operator Apply Association Rules.
